Ismaila Cheick Coulibaly (born 25 December 2000) is a Malian footballer who plays as a midfielder for Austrian Bundesliga club LASK and the Mali national team.
Career
On 14 January 2019, Sarpsborg 08 announced the signing of Coulibaly to a four-year contract.[3]
On 9 September 2020, Premier League club Sheffield United announced the signing of Coulibaly[4] and immediately sent him to Belgian First Division A side Beerschot on a three-year loan deal.[5] The loan was terminated after two seasons following Beerschot's relegation from the Belgian top tier.
Coulibaly made his debut for the senior squad of Sheffield United on 7 January 2023 in a FA Cup matchup against Millwall[6] and made his first start on 7 February 2023 in the fourth-round replay win over Wrexham.[7] 4 days later he made his league debut as a late substitute in a 3–0 EFL Championship victory over Swansea City.[8]
On 3 January 2025, Coulibaly joined Austrian Bundesliga side LASK on a three-and-a-half year deal for an undisclosed fee.[9][10]
International career
In late March 2023, he made his international debut for Mali.[11]
